The only people who are saying the "the world will end" are the ones who don't understand typical accounting practices. Again, it's a metric that helps companies and investors make a decision on what to do next and is not solely about whether or not they kill something or not.
To be clear and to avoid added confusion: the expected lifespan cited in the Annual Report is not used for that kind of metric.
Its only function is to account for revenue raised from the sale of Lifetime Expansion Passes.
